Graves’ disease following commencement of alemtuzumab therapy: case report discussing clinical considerations and possible pathophysiology

Abstract
BACKGROUND Monoclonal antibodies have become a mainstay in the treatment of autoimmune, viral and malignant disease. Many adverse reactions to antibody therapy are unpredictable and include endocrinopathies. The monoclonal antibody alemtuzumab is licensed for the treatment of MS but induces Graves’ disease in 22% of patients receiving the drug for this indication. Alemtuzumab targets CD52 which depletes mature lymphocytes. In this case report, a patient who developed Graves’ disease following alemtuzumab therapy is discussed and clinical considerations and pathophysiology are reviewed. CASE DESCRIPTION SK is a 37-year-old woman diagnosed with MS at 25, and also suffers from depression. SK began alemtuzumab treatment at aged 35, subsequently, she was found to have deranged TFTs (TSH <0.01 mU/L and fT4 28 pmol/L). SK experienced regular palpitations, fatigue and disturbed sleep. The patient attributed her fatigue and palpitations to MS and did not seek medical attention. SK reported no other symptoms of hyperthyroidism. Symptoms resolved following administration of carbimazole and propranolol. DISCUSSION The exact mechanisms underlying both MS and alemtuzumab-induced Graves’ disease are unknown. Lymphocyte depletion and reconstitution are thought to cause autoimmunity by the over-repopulation of naïve B-cells, modulation of T-lymphocytes and disruption of cytokine signalling (IL-21 and IFNy). The slow regeneration of Treg cells that normally promote tolerance underlies these changes. This report identifies several clinical challenges, including the detection of adverse reactions to new medications, ensuring thorough symptom reporting, and the fragility of quality of life in patients with MS.
